Democrats' redistricting push in blue state hits legal snag

A Maryland court blocked Democrats from adding a congressional redistricting initiative to the November ballot on Wednesday.

The Democrat-backed effort would have allowed Maryland residents to vote on an amendment to the state constitution to let lawmakers redraw district maps ahead of the 2028 elections.

The amendment would have removed the requirement that congressional districts be compact and follow "natural boundaries." Democrats already control seven of Maryland's eight congressional districts.

Andy Harris, R-Md., represents the district situated the eastern shore of the Chesapeake Bay, and the change would allow Democrats to reshape his district.

County Circuit Court Judge Robert Thompson ruled that Democrats had violated state deadlines for adding ballot measures.

Earlier this year, Maryland Democrats passed a law requiring the Maryland secretary of state to certify ballot summaries by July 1, but the amendment was submitted after that date.

"The case has never been about preventing Marylanders from having a voice, it’s been about ensuring that before voters are asked to amend the constitution, the state first complies with the constitution and the election procedures established by law," the statement read, according to Fox 5 DC.

Republicans and Democrats are vying for any and every advantage leading into the 2026 midterm elections .

A similar effort by Democrats was struck down in Virginia earlier this year by the state supreme court.

Texas successfully redrew its maps in favor of Republicans, while California did the same in favor of Democrats.

Redistricting battles remain ongoing in Georgia and elsewhere.
